    Job DescriptionThe Associate Community Manager is responsible for effectively marketing the community and ensuring the leasing targets are achieved. The Associate Community Manager places our prospects' and residents' needs, requests, and follow-up as a top priority. The Associate Community Manager should always maintain a level of professionalism and courtesy.
